ALPA EMERGENCY RELIEF FUND INC, founded in 2005, is a community nonprofit in the Public Safety sector that reported $1.1M in total revenue in fiscal year 2022. Revenue surged 631%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$913K, a strong 85% operating margin.

Mission

TO PROVIDE GRANTS AND/OR LOANS TO ALPA MEMBERS WHO SUFFER FINANCIAL HARDSHIPS AS A RESULT OF NATURAL AND MAN-MADE DISASTERS.
